loanDepot (NYSE:LDI) CEO Anthony Li Hsieh Sells 178,501 Shares

loanDepot, Inc. (NYSE:LDIGet Free Report) CEO Anthony Li Hsieh sold 178,501 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ction dated Monday, November 17th. The stock was sold at an average price of $2.50, for a total value of $446,252.50.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which is available through this link.

loanDepot Company Profile

loanDepot, Inc engages in originating, financing, selling, and servicing residential mortgage loans in the United States. The company offers conventional agency-conforming and prime jumbo, federal assistance residential mortgage, and home equity loans. It also provides settlement services, which include captive title and escrow business; real estate services that cover captive real estate referral business; and insurance services, including services to homeowners, as well as other consumer insurance policies.
